Output 6571605f85092f3fcd25665996297e2a8e014c9ee597f6de89335b912e66ecc3:71

value
250354
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fe6dbff5028baf69057ed9b1714a51a3a77e7b7f OP_EQUALVERIFY OP_CHECKSIG
address
1QCJ7H4hEJ9vysboXtoiLMLtvsMgDJea2q
transaction
6571605f85092f3fcd25665996297e2a8e014c9ee597f6de89335b912e66ecc3
confirmations
168210
spent
true